BASIL VEGETABLE STRATA

I've been cooking this strata for years, and my family just can't get enough! The fresh basil gives this healthy brunch dish an added flavor boost. -Jean L. Ecos, Hartland, Wisconsin.

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, heat 1 teaspoon oil over medium-high heat. Add mushrooms; cook and stir until tender, 8-10 minutes. Remove from pan., In same pan, heat 1 teaspoon oil over medium heat. Add onion; cook and stir until golden brown, 6-8 minutes. Remove from pan and add to the mushrooms., Add remaining oil to pan. Add peppers, leek, salt and pepper; cook and stir until leek is tender, 6-8 minutes. Stir in sauteed mushrooms and onion., In a 13x9-in. baking dish coated with cooking spray, layer half of each of the following: bread cubes, vegetable mixture, mozzarella cheese and Parmesan cheese. Repeat layers. In a large bowl, whisk eggs, egg whites and milk until blended; pour over layers. Sprinkle with basil. Refrigerate, covered, overnight., Preheat oven to 350°. Remove strata from refrigerator while oven heats., Bake, covered, 50 minutes. Bake, uncovered, until lightly browned and a knife inserted in the center comes out clean, 10-15 minutes longer. Let stand 10 minutes before serving.

3 teaspoons canola oil, divided
3/4 pound sliced fresh mushrooms
1 cup finely chopped sweet onion
1 large sweet red pepper, cut into strips
1 large sweet yellow pepper, thin strips
1 medium leek (white portion only), chopped
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on pepper
10 slices whole wheat bread, cut into 1-inch pieces
1-1/2 cups shredded part-skim mozzarella cheese
1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
8 large eggs
4 large egg whites
2-1/2 cups fat-free milk
1/4 cup chopped fresh basil

MAKE-AHEAD SPINACH AND MOZZARELLA BREAKFAST STRATA

This make-ahead breakfast/brunch strata has cheese, eggs, and nutritious value from spinach.

Steps:

  • Melt butter in a medium skillet over medium heat. Add onion and saute until soft, about 5 minutes. Add herbes de Provence, salt, and pepper; continue to cook for 1 minute more. Stir in spinach, remove from heat, and set aside.
  • Spray the inside of a 3-quart (9x13-inch) baking dish with cooking spray. Layer the bottom of the dish with 1/3 of the bread cubes. Top with 1/3 of the spinach mixture and 1/3 mozzarella cheese. Repeat these layers twice more with remaining bread, spinach mixture, and cheese.
  • Combine eggs, milk, salt, and pepper in a medium bowl. Whisk together until blended. Pour evenly over the bread and spinach layered in the baking dish. Cover with plastic wrap and chill for at least 8 hours, up to 1 day.
  • Remove from the refrigerator 30 minutes before baking to allow pan to get to room temperature.
  • Meanwhile, pre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Bake, uncovered, in the preheated oven until puffed, golden brown, and cooked through, 45 to 55 minutes. Let stand at least 5 minutes before serving.

3 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 ½ cups finely chopped yellow onion
3 pinches herbes de Provence, or to taste
salt and ground black pepper to taste
2 (10 ounce) packages frozen chopped spinach, thawed and drained
butter-flavored cooking spray
8 cups cubed Italian bread
1 cup shredded reduced-fat mozzarella cheese, or more to taste
9 large eggs
1 cup skim milk

ROASTED VEGETABLE STRATA

With the abundance of zucchini my family has in the fall, this is the perfect dish to use some of what we have. Cheesy and rich, the warm, classic breakfast dish is sure to please! -Colleen Doucette, Truro, Nova Scotia

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400°. Toss zucchini and peppers with oil and seasonings; transfer to a 15x10x1-in. pan. Roast until tender, 25-30 minutes, stirring once. Stir in tomato; cool slightly., Trim ends from bread; cut bread into 1-in. slices. In a greased 13x9-in. baking dish, layer half of each of the following: bread, roasted vegetables and cheeses. Repeat layers. Whisk together eggs and milk; pour evenly over top. Refrigerate, covered, 6 hours or overnight., Preheat oven to 375°. Remove casserole from refrigerator while oven heats. Bake, uncovered, until golden brown, 40-50 minutes. Let stand 5-10 minutes before cutting. Freeze option: Cover and freeze unbaked casserole. To use, partially thaw in refrigerator overnight. Remove from refrigerator 30 minutes before baking. Preheat oven to 375°. Bake casserole as directed, increasing time as necessary to heat through and for a thermometer inserted in center to read 165°.

3 large zucchini, halved lengthwise and cut into 3/4-inch slices
1 each medium red, yellow and orange peppers, cut into 1-inch pieces
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on pepper
1/2 teaspoon dried basil
1 medium tomato, chopped
1 loaf (1 pound) unsliced crusty Italian bread
1/2 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
1/2 cup shredded Asiago cheese
6 large eggs
2 cups fat-free milk

MOZZARELLA AND PESTO STRATA

Have an Italian-style brunch. This strata is made with basil pesto, olives and roasted red bell peppers baked under a layer of eggs and cheese.

Steps:

  • Spray rectangular baking dish, 13x9x2 inches, with cooking spray. Spread one side of each bread slice with pesto. Arrange bread, pesto sides up, in bottom of baking dish, cutting slices to fit if necessary. Sprinkle with olives, bell peppers and mozzarella cheese.
  • Beat eggs, milk, salt and pepper until well blended. Pour evenly over cheese in dish. Sprinkle with Parmesan cheese. Cover and refrigerate at least 2 hours but not longer than 24 hours.
  • Heat oven to 325°F. Bake uncovered 55 to 60 minutes or until knife inserted in center comes out clean and top is golden brown. Let stand 5 minutes before cutting.

16 slices (3/4 inch thick) French bread (1/2 pound)
1/2 cup basil pesto
1/2 cup sliced ripe olives
1 cup roasted red bell peppers, (from 12-ounce jar), drained and sliced
2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ese (8 ounces)
8 eggs
2 cups milk
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
2 tablespoons freshly shredded Parmesan cheese

BROCCOLI, MUSHROOM, AND CHEESE BREAKFAST STRATA

Steps:

  • Heat 2 teaspoons of the oil in a nonstick skillet over medium heat. Add the onions and saute until translucent and beginning to brown, about 4 minutes. Add the garlic and continue to cook for another 1 minute. Transfer the onion mixture to a medium bowl and allow to cool. Heat remaining 2 teaspoons of oil in the skillet and saute the mushrooms until they release all of their water, about 6 to 7 minutes. Remove from heat and cool completely. Spray an oval baking dish with cooking spray. Arrange the bread cubes in the dish. In a large bowl, beat the eggs, egg whites, milk and mustard until incorporated. Add mushrooms, onion-garlic mixture, broccoli, Parmesan and mozzarella cheeses, sun-dried tomatoes, thyme, and salt and pepper and stir to incorporate. Pour mixture over bread, making sure liquid saturates bread.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ate overnight, or at least 8 hours.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Remove the plastic wrap from strata and bake for 55 to 60 minutes, or until top forms a light brown crust.

4 teaspoons olive oil
1 large onion, diced (about 2 cups)
3 garlic cloves, minced
3 cups (8 ounces) sliced mushrooms
Nonstick cooking spray
1 whole wheat baguette, crusts removed, cubed (about 5 cups)
8 eggs and 8 egg whites
2 cups low-fat milk
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
10 ounces broccoli, steamed, cooled and chopped (or frozen, thawed)
1-ounce (1/3 cup) grated Parmesan
4-ounce (1 cup) part-skim mozzarella cheese
1/2 cup thinly sliced sun-dried tomatoes, reconstituted
1 tablespoon minced fresh thyme leaves
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ground pepper

VEGETABLE AND CHEESE STRATA

Steps:

  • In a large skillet cook the onion, the scallion, and the mushrooms in the oil over moderately low heat, stirring, until the onion is softened, add the bell peppers and salt and pepper to taste, and cook the mixture over moderate heat, stirring, for 10 to 15 minutes, or until all the liquid the mushrooms give off is evaporated and the peppers are tender. Arrange half the bread cubes in a buttered large shallow (4 1/2-quart) baking dish, spread half the vegetable mixture over them, and sprinkle half the Cheddar and half the Parmesan over the vegetables. Arrange the remaining bread cubes over the cheeses, top them with the remaining vegetables, and sprinkle the remaining cheeses over the top. In a bowl whisk together the eggs, the milk, the mustard, the Tabasco, and salt and pepper to taste, pour the egg mixture evenly over the strata, and chill the strata, covered, overnight. Let the strata stand at room temperature for 15 minutes and bake it in the middle of a preheated 350°F. oven for 50 minutes to 1 hour, or until it is puffed and golden and cooked through.

1 1/2 cups finely chopped onion
1 cup finely chopped scallion
3/4 pound mushrooms, sliced thin
3 tablespoons olive oil
2 red bell peppers, cut into thin strips (about 2 cups)
2 green bell peppers, cut into thin strips (about 2 cups)
enough Italian bread cut into 1-inch cubes to measure 9 cups (about 1 1/2 loaves)
2 1/2 cups coarsely grated extra-sharp Cheddar (about 10 ounces)
1 cup freshly grated Parmesan
12 large eggs
3 1/2 cups milk
3 tablespoons Dijon-style mustard
Tabasco to taste

VEGETABLE STRATA

Add mushroom, tomato and broccoli to this cheesy strata for a gorgeous breakfast or dinner.

Steps:

  • Butter a 9-by-13-inch baking dish.
  • Heat the o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at until hot. Add the mushrooms and cook, stirring occasionally, until golden brown, 6 to 8 minutes. Season with salt and pepper. Set aside.
  • Meanwhile, bring a medium p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the broccoli until crisp-tender, 3 to 4 minutes; drain and set aside.
  • Whisk together the half-and-half, Parmesan, eggs, 1 1/2 teaspoons salt and a few grinds of pepper in a large bowl.
  • Layer half of the bread cubes in the prepared baking dish. Sprinkle with 1 1/2 cups of the Monterey Jack, followed by the mushrooms, broccoli, scallions and tomatoes. Cover with the remaining bread cubes and pour the egg mixture evenly over the top.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ate overnight. (This can also be assembled the day of; just let soak at room temperature 30 minutes to 1 hour before baking.)
  • On the day of baking, preheat the oven to 325 degrees F. Let the strata sit at room temperature while the oven preheats. Remove the plastic and sprinkle with the remaining 1/2 cup Monterey Jack. Bake until slightly puffed and just no longer jiggly in the center, 40 to 50 minutes. Let stand 5 minutes before serving.

Unsalted butter, at room temperature, for the baking dish
2 tablespoons olive oil
12 ounces cremini mushrooms, thinly sliced
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 1/2 cups bite-size broccoli florets
3 cups half-and-half
1/4 cup grated Parmesan
10 large eggs
One 12-ounce loaf rustic Italian bread, preferably stale, crusts removed, cut into 1-inch cubes (about 6 cups)
2 cups shredded Monterey Jack cheese
1/4 cup thinly sliced scallions
2 plum tomatoes, seeded and chopped

VEGETABLE STRATA

Steps:

  • With a paper towel, rub a little olive oil in a 13 X 9 X 2 inch, 2 1/2-quart baking dish. In a large non-stick skillet, water sauté onion, garlic, bell peppers, broccoli, and herb de Provence. Cook covered, over medium heat for 5 minutes. Add water as necessary to prevent scorching. Add spinach and cook until wilted. Spread bread squares evenly in baking dish and top with vegetables. Sprinkle mozzarella cheese evenly over vegetables. In a bowl whisk together whole eggs, egg whites, soy milk, parsley, any vegetable liquid, and pepper flakes. Pour evenly over bread and vegetables. At this point you may chill strata, covered, at least 3 hours and up to 12 but that is optional. Preheat oven to 350°F. Meanwhile, let strata stand at room temperature 20 minutes. Bake in middle of oven 45 to 55 minutes, or until puffed and golden brown around edges. Serve strata topped with tomato salsa.

1 large leek or onion, sliced thin
5 cloves garlic, pressed or minced
1 large red bell pepper, sliced thin (about 2 cups)
1 pound frozen broccoli florets
1 teaspoon dried herb de Provence
6 ounces fresh organic spinach or 1 bag organic baby spinach
12 slices multi-grain bread, (crust removed) cut into 3/4-inch squares
4 ounces mozzarella cheese substitute Soya Kaas, shredded
2 large whole eggs
10 large egg whites
2 1/2 cups unsweetened soy milk
1/2 cup chopped fresh parsley or 2 tablespoons dried parsley
1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es
1 1/2 cups low sodium tomato salsa
